How to Clean with Lemon Oil and Tea Tree Oil

Image
I am ALL for cleaning my house naturally. The chemicals we run into daily considering pollution, every day household cleaners and even playing on a lawn that has pesticides on it do take a toll on our bodies, whether we see it or not. That being said, I am so happy to have both of these essential oils to help me clean my home! We have all seen the commercials about having to use bleach to get a home clean. That isn't necessarily true. Tea Tree Oil is a natural anti-microbial and can kill off bacteria and germs in the home and Lemon oil is a natural disinfectant, so perfect for cleaning anywhere in your home. Lemon oil also is great for cleaning wood and helps shine tarnished silver and stainless steel.
